Crafting the Perfect Release Strategy for Your Next Software Tool
A cinematic approach to software releases: teasers, betas, live premieres, and playbooks to launch tools with traction and reliability.
Crafting the Perfect Release Strategy for Your Next Software Tool
Big movie releases use trailers, mystery, timed exclusives and press blitzes to sell seats. Software tools should borrow that playbook: well-timed teasers, staged reveals, community-first premieres and deliberate fallback plans for outages. This guide turns cinematic launch thinking into an operational, repeatable product launch playbook for developer tools, SaaS features, and utilities — from pre-launch tactics to promotional strategies and post-launch measurement.
Why Treat a Software Release Like a Movie Premiere
Expectation creates velocity
When audiences anticipate a film they show up on opening weekend. For software tools, managed anticipation drives first-week activations, referral momentum, and PR coverage. Use teaser campaigns and micro-reveals to build scarcity and curiosity rather than posting a single release note. For creative inspiration on staged storytelling in launches, see how cultural rollouts use visual-first tactics in How Mitski Used Horror Cinema to Launch a Single: A Playbook for Visual-First Music Releases and how a horror-themed rollout leaned into mood to drive attention in How to Build a Horror-Influenced Album Rollout (Lessons from Mitski’s New Era).
Control the narrative — and the risks
Hollywood spends for PR insurance and contingency plans; your engineering roadmap must do the same. Design resilient architectures, incident plans and rollback criteria before the release. Learn practical design patterns for outages and resilience in Designing Resilient Architectures After the Cloudflare/AWS/X Outage Spike.
Cross-functional premieres: marketing + engineering
Successful launches require synchronized timing between product, marketing, legal and SRE. That means joint calendars, shared acceptance criteria and mock launch rehearsals. If you want to scale launch playbooks across teams, audit your stack and remove redundant tools first: follow the guidance in SaaS Stack Audit: A step-by-step playbook to detect tool sprawl and cut costs and Audit Your MarTech Stack: A Practical Checklist for Removing Redundant Contact Tools.
Plan: Goals, Audience, and Signal Metrics
Define measurable goals
Start with 3-5 primary metrics that determine success: activation rate, retention at day 7, net new accounts, trial-to-paid conversion, and NPS change. Avoid vanity metrics; tie KPIs to revenue or meaningful product use. Map each marketing activity to a leading indicator (e.g., teaser signups -> activation rate).
Segment your audience
Define who sees which teaser. Early adopters, power users, enterprise prospects and partners all need different messaging. Run closed betas for power users while preparing a broad demo and launch narrative for the general market. If you need a fast build/test cycle for prototypes or micro-features, consider tactical sprints like From Idea to Prod in a Weekend: Building Secure Micro‑Apps with Mongoose and Node.js or the low-code sprint model in Build a Micro App in 7 Days: A Practical Low-Code Sprint for Busy Teams.
Map the buyer journey to content assets
Create a content matrix: teaser video, explainer blog, technical deep-dive, integration case study, quickstart guides, and webinar. Ensure technical docs and getting-started flows are production-ready before the public reveal. If you're converting an idea from a chat-based prototype into a maintainable service, our engineering playbook From Chat Prompt to Production: How to Turn a 'Micro' App Built with ChatGPT into a Maintainable Service is directly relevant.
Pre-Launch Tactics: Teasers, Betas, and Stunts
Design a tiered teaser campaign
Layer your pre-launch teasers over 4–8 weeks: cryptic micro-updates for social, a product countdown, early access signups, and a technical sneak peek for developer audiences. Teasers should reveal value, not friction: short videos, GIFs of the UX, and a single clear CTA to a waitlist or demo. Examine cross-industry teasers and how stunts can amplify attention — for inspiration, read Behind the Backflip: How Rimmel’s Gravity-Defying Mascara Launch Uses Stunts to Sell Beauty.
Run a staged beta with clear feedback loops
Use an invite-only beta to gather product telemetry and iron out onboarding. Provide an in-app feedback channel, weekly release notes for beta users, and direct Slack/Discord access for power testers. If you need a runnable template to prototype quickly, check micro-app templates like Build a ‘micro’ dining app in 7 days: a runnable full‑stack template with AI prompts and the low-code sprint options above.
Use narrative positioning: theme your launch
A themed launch frames creative assets and press hooks. Giants and indie bands use themes (horror, mystery, stunt) to excite communities; translate that to product by staging release notes as episodes, creating a launch trailer, or producing a short explainer with strong visual identity. See these artistic rollouts for creative techniques in How to Build a Horror-Influenced Album Rollout (Lessons from Mitski’s New Era) and How Mitski Used Horror Cinema to Launch a Single: A Playbook for Visual-First Music Releases.
Promotional Strategies That Scale
Earned, owned and paid — balanced
Mix PR and influencer seeding with technical content and targeted paid campaigns. Use owned assets (blog, docs, changelog) for SEO, paid search/social for top-of-funnel, and expert reviews or guest posts for credibility. Train your marketing team fast on modern channels; the guided approach in Learn Marketing Faster: A Student’s Guide to Using Gemini Guided Learning can accelerate onboarding.
Partnerships and integrations as amplifiers
Strategic integrations with platform partners produce co-marketing opportunities — joint webinars, co-branded content and shared distribution. Make technical integrations launch-ready with compatibility tests and published integration docs before go-live.
Stunts, case studies and social proof
Timed stunts or a bold early customer case study can break through noise. Creative industries use stunts (see Rimmel's backflip), but ensure double-checked logistics and legal approval. For stunt ideas and how they translate to publicity, read Behind the Backflip: How Rimmel’s Gravity-Defying Mascara Launch Uses Stunts to Sell Beauty.
Live Launch Events and Streaming
Choose the right platform architecture
Decide where to premiere: a product webinar, Product Hunt, YouTube livestream, or multi-platform stream across Bluesky and Twitch. For simultaneous multi-platform streaming techniques, implement the steps in How to Stream to Bluesky and Twitch at the Same Time: A Technical Playbook.
Identity, moderation and badges
Authenticate your stream channels and claim cross-platform badges to reduce impersonation risk and increase discoverability. Follow the DNS-based verification workflow described in Verify Your Live-Stream Identity: Claiming Twitch, Bluesky and Cross-Platform Badges with DNS, and implement live-moderation tagging strategies explained in How to Tag Live Streams: A Playbook for Capitalizing on Bluesky’s LIVE and Twitch Integration.
Design badges and overlays that match your brand
Custom stream overlays, badges and on-screen CTAs keep viewers on message and help convert watchers into early signups. Use the design patterns in Designing Live-Stream Badges for Twitch and New Social Platforms and the implementation steps of How to Use Bluesky’s LIVE Badge and Twitch Integration: A Step-by-Step Guide for Streamers.
If monetization is part of your plan, look at practical playbooks for converting live streams into revenue in How to Turn Live-Streaming on Bluesky and Twitch into Paid Microgigs.
Pro Tip: Rehearse your live launch like a staged production — run full dress rehearsals with engineering on-call, the marketing script, and a simulated outage to validate rollback procedures.
User Engagement: Onboarding, Retention, and Community
Design the first 10 minutes
Activation happens in the first session. Provide an opinionated default, an interactive quickstart, and an easy-to-skip tutorial. Track in-session funnels to identify drop-off points and iterate quickly. Consider offering exclusive in-session content during launch windows to incentivize engagement.
Community seeding and migration
Seeding community with advocates before launch reduces churn. If you plan platform pivots or cross-platform engagement, study the migration playbook in Switching Platforms Without Losing Your Community: A Playbook for Moving from X/Reddit to Friendlier Networks Like Digg and Bluesky to avoid losing momentum.
Reward early adopters
Early adopters convert to evangelists when rewarded: lifetime discounts, exclusive features, special badges, or forum privileges. Use referral loops and milestone rewards to convert community enthusiasm into signups.
Measurement, Incident Response and Post‑Launch Iteration
Instrument for rapid diagnosis
Instrument feature flags, telemetry and observability before launch. Capture latencies, error rates, sign-up funnels and first-week retention by cohort. Ensure your incident runbook is accessible and that communication templates exist for status pages and social updates.
Run a launch retrospective
Within two weeks of launch, run a blameless retrospective that covers metrics, customer feedback, and ops gaps. Feed findings back into the roadmap and prioritize fixes by customer impact.
Iterate with feature flags
Use gradual rollouts and kill-switch feature flags to minimize blast radius. A staged rollout lets you open new capabilities to 1%, 10%, then 100% while monitoring KPIs and error budgets.
Case Study Walkthrough: Five Launch Approaches Compared
Below is a condensed comparison of common release approaches. Choose the approach that matches your product-market fit, risk tolerance, and available marketing budget.
| Approach | Best for | Time to Market | Cost | Primary Risk |
|---|---|---|---|---|
| Teaser + Public Launch | Consumer-facing tools, viral potential | 6–12 weeks | Medium | Overhype, unmet expectations |
| Invite-only Beta | Developer tools, early adopters | 4–8 weeks | Low–Medium | Slow adoption if closed too long |
| Enterprise Pilot | Large customers, integrations | 8–24 weeks | High | Long feedback cycles |
| Product Hunt / Community Drop | Indie SaaS and side projects | 2–6 weeks | Low | Requires community momentum |
| Live Stream Premiere + Stunt | Brand-driven launches with narrative | 4–10 weeks | Medium–High | Logistics or moderation failures |
For a technical playbook to stream across modern platforms and create a polished live premiere, see How to Stream to Bluesky and Twitch at the Same Time: A Technical Playbook, and for tags/moderation the practical steps in How to Tag Live Streams: A Playbook for Capitalizing on Bluesky’s LIVE and Twitch Integration.
90-Day Launch Checklist and Timeline
Day 90–60: Discovery and MVP
Confirm primary metrics, segment audiences, build core onboarding flows, and rehearse your demo. If you need fast prototyping, consult the micro-app sprint patterns in Build a Micro App in 7 Days: A Practical Low-Code Sprint for Busy Teams and From Idea to Prod in a Weekend: Building Secure Micro‑Apps with Mongoose and Node.js.
Day 60–30: Teasers and Partner Outreach
Launch teasers, seed partners, build landing pages and finalize press kit. Lock in your streaming channels and verify identities using Verify Your Live-Stream Identity: Claiming Twitch, Bluesky and Cross-Platform Badges with DNS.
Day 30–0: Beta, Rehearse, and Launch
Run open/closed beta, perform technical rehearsals and finalize comms templates. On launch day, stream your premiere (technical guidance in How to Use Bluesky’s LIVE Badge and Twitch Integration: A Step-by-Step Guide for Streamers) and monitor KPIs in realtime.
Maintain Control: Tooling, Cost, and Team Playbooks
Audit tools before scaling campaigns
Marketing and product teams often accumulate overlapping tools. Complete a stack audit to cut costs and reduce complexity; see the method in SaaS Stack Audit: A step-by-step playbook to detect tool sprawl and cut costs and the enterprise perspective in Tool Sprawl Assessment Playbook for Enterprise DevOps.
Coordinate comms and legal sign‑offs
Pre-approve legal language, privacy disclosures and security claims, and prepare a short FAQ for customers and press. Create escalation paths for on-call engineers and legal counsel in case the launch triggers compliance questions.
Train the team on roles and scripts
Run tabletop exercises for customer support, PR, and incident response. Assign spokespeople and prepare templated status updates — rehearsed scripts save precious minutes under pressure.
Conclusion: Launch as an Engine, Not an Event
Think of launches as a repeatable engine: with rehearsed playbooks, themeable creative assets, carefully staged teasers and enforceable operational guardrails. Use the channels and technical playbooks above to stage a premiere that both delights customers and preserves reliability. For creative and PR inspiration, review music and entertainment rollouts such as How to Build a Horror-Influenced Album Rollout (Lessons from Mitski’s New Era) and case studies like Behind the Backflip: How Rimmel’s Gravity-Defying Mascara Launch Uses Stunts to Sell Beauty.
FAQ — Common Questions About Software Launches
Q1: How long should my pre-launch teaser run?
A1: Typically 4–8 weeks depending on complexity. Shorter product-market fits with ready-made audiences can compress to 2–4 weeks; enterprise releases often need 8+ weeks for pilots and legal clearance.
Q2: Should I do a public launch or invite-only beta?
A2: Use invite-only betas for complex developer workflows or high integration risk. Public launches work well when you need network effects or virality. Hybrid approaches (closed beta + Product Hunt premiere) often balance risk and reach.
Q3: What technical rehearsals are essential before a live stream premiere?
A3: Full dress rehearsal with real load tests, failover drills, and moderation rehearsals. Verify streaming credentials and badges using instructions like Verify Your Live-Stream Identity: Claiming Twitch, Bluesky and Cross-Platform Badges with DNS.
Q4: How do I avoid tool sprawl while running multi-channel campaigns?
A4: Conduct a stack audit, remove redundant tools and centralize tracking. See practical checklists in SaaS Stack Audit: A step-by-step playbook to detect tool sprawl and cut costs and Audit Your MarTech Stack: A Practical Checklist for Removing Redundant Contact Tools.
Q5: Can live streaming be monetized during product launches?
A5: Yes. Live streams can drive direct sales, paid workshops, and microgigs; for practical monetization techniques, review How to Turn Live-Streaming on Bluesky and Twitch into Paid Microgigs.
Related Reading
- From Chat Prompt to Production: How to Turn a 'Micro' App Built with ChatGPT into a Maintainable Service - Technical follow-up for prototype-to-prod workflows.
- SaaS Stack Audit: A step-by-step playbook to detect tool sprawl and cut costs - Reduce tool bloat before scaling campaigns.
- How to Stream to Bluesky and Twitch at the Same Time: A Technical Playbook - Multi-platform streaming best practices.
- Verify Your Live-Stream Identity: Claiming Twitch, Bluesky and Cross-Platform Badges with DNS - Security and discoverability for live channels.
- Switching Platforms Without Losing Your Community: A Playbook for Moving from X/Reddit to Friendlier Networks Like Digg and Bluesky - Keep your launch community intact when platforms change.
Related Topics
Evan Mercer
Senior Editor & Product Launch Strategist
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.
Up Next
More stories handpicked for you
Hands-On: Building a Desktop Agent That Automates Repetitive Dev Tasks Safely
How to Evaluate AI Data Marketplaces: Metrics, Red Flags, and Integration Steps
Human Native and the Future of Paid Training Data: Best Practices for Dataset Providers
From Our Network
Trending stories across our publication group